              The Mall here in Syracuse has like 35 entrances(not exaggerating) so the company that runs the mall would have to buy about 40 metal detectors, wands, and hire 105 security guards.

              A quick google search tells me that a metal detector costs about $2500-$4000 so well just say $3000 for arguments sake. Wands are about $40,and we will assume the people you are hiring are going to make $11/hr. Start up costs alone will be about $120,000. After you add in insurance and benefits, each employee will cost about$30,000 per year, so now we have a yearly operating cost of about 3,150,000. These are all low ball estimates but you get the picture. And thats the reason why we dont have metal detectors in malls.
